PRACTICE & DRESS CODE
Practice Facilities
- Driving Range (Grass & Mats)
- Practice Chipping & Sand Areas
- Practice Putting Green
Dress Code
- Collared Shirt Required.
- NO Denim and bermuda style shorts only.
- Soft Spikes Only.
